Spring整合ibatis的配置
2009-03-10 16:45
363 查看
在applicationContext.xml文件中
使用了DBCP数据库连接池
<bean id="dataSource" class="org.apache.commons.dbcp.BasicDataSource" destroy-method="close">
<property name="driverClassName"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://127.0.0.1:3306/mtg"/>
<property name="username" value="mtg"/>
<property name="password" value="mtg321"/>
<property name="maxActive" value="50"/>
<property name="maxIdle" value="20"/>
<property name="maxWait" value="1000"/>
<property name="defaultAutoCommit" value="true"/>
<property name="removeAbandoned" value="true"/>
<property name="removeAbandonedTimeout" value="60"/>
</bean>
<bean id="sqlMapClient" class="org.springframework.orm.ibatis.SqlMapClientFactoryBean">
<property name="configLocation" value="/WEB-INF/classes/com/cdeledu/mis/mtg/current/config/ibatis-config.xml"></property
<property name="dataSource">
<ref bean="dataSource"/>
</property>
</bean>
在ibatis-config.xml文件中
<sqlMapConfig>
<sqlMap resource="com/cdeledu/mis/mtg/current/sql/Users.xml"/>
</sqlMapConfig>
使用了DBCP数据库连接池
<bean id="dataSource" class="org.apache.commons.dbcp.BasicDataSource" destroy-method="close">
<property name="driverClassName" value="com.mysql.jdbc.Driver"/>
<property name="url" value="jdbc:mysql://127.0.0.1:3306/mtg"/>
<property name="username" value="mtg"/>
<property name="password" value="mtg321"/>
<property name="maxActive" value="50"/>
<property name="maxIdle" value="20"/>
<property name="maxWait" value="1000"/>
<property name="defaultAutoCommit" value="true"/>
<property name="removeAbandoned" value="true"/>
<property name="removeAbandonedTimeout" value="60"/>
</bean>
<bean id="sqlMapClient" class="org.springframework.orm.ibatis.SqlMapClientFactoryBean">
<property name="configLocation" value="/WEB-INF/classes/com/cdeledu/mis/mtg/current/config/ibatis-config.xml"></property
<property name="dataSource">
<ref bean="dataSource"/>
</property>
</bean>
在ibatis-config.xml文件中
<sqlMapConfig>
<sqlMap resource="com/cdeledu/mis/mtg/current/sql/Users.xml"/>
</sqlMapConfig>
相关文章推荐
- ibatis,Spring 使用annotation整合配置
- ibatis整合spring SQL文件配置
- spring整合log4j配置仅输出mybatis/ibatis的sql语句
- Spring 3.0 整合 iBatis 3 Beta10 配置
- webwork+spring+ibatis整合配置
- Struts Spring Ibatis整合框架搭建配置文档
- 关于搭建restful web service + springMVC + ibatis/hibernate的整合和XML配置意思和ssh+springMVC框架搭建
- SSI整合以及缓存的配置(struts2.2.1.1 + spring3.0.1 + ibatis2.3.0.677)
- AOP注解配置+Spring整合JDBC+Spring整合ibatis
- Spring整合ibatis开发配置
- struts+spring+ibatis+velocity整合配置
- spring整合ibatis步骤及配置文件
- struts2 ibatis spring 框架整合配置文件的设置
- Spring 整合Hibernate的配置
- Spring + mvc,Mybatis整合 (含事务配置,分页功能)
- Spring整合iBatis之二:从iBatis角度看两框架整合
- Spring整合Hibernate配置(使用hibernate.cfg.xml文件)
- SSI(Struts2, Spring, iBatis)框架整合小结
- spring整合mybatis(开启包扫描器)出现db.properties配置文件失效的解决方案
- spring-mabatis整合的配置文件